

The P-test is a test for Chlamydia & Gonorrhoea. For males, the test will be a urine sample so do not pass urine for 1 hour prior to taking a sample. For females, the test is a self-taken lower vaginal swab. The tests are easy to do and step-by-step instructions are provided.
Most people do not show symptoms. A course of antibiotics is all
that is needed to cure it. Remember, you should have a test every time
you sleep with someone new (without using a condom).
